What Is Chapter 11 Bankruptcy?

Chapter 11 bankruptcy reorganizes business debts for companies to help make the business profitable. Chapter 11 allows the business to continue operating during the bankruptcy proceedings. The reorganization plan can include partial repayments to priority creditors, closing some operations, selling assets, and more. Creditors can try to convert the bankruptcy to Chapter 7 if they are unhappy with the reorganization plan.

What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Chapter 11 Bankruptcy Lawyer?

If you run or own a business, whether it is a corporation, partnership, or small business, you should consider talking to a business bankruptcy lawyer if:

  • Your business is struggling with staying profitable due to rising debts
  • Creditors are threatening to file lawsuits or seize business assets
  • You believe there is a path back to profitability for your company

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Bankruptcy Lawyer?

Not hiring a bankruptcy lawyer can lead to costly errors and prolonged financial stress. If you don’t hire a bankruptcy lawyer, you might make mistakes in the bankruptcy process. These mistakes could lead to your case being dismissed. Without a lawyer’s guidance, you could miss out on important protections, such as stopping creditor harassment or preventing foreclosure. You might also choose the wrong type of bankruptcy, resulting in more financial trouble. Handling bankruptcy alone increases the risk of losing assets you could have kept and wanted to keep. Additionally, you may struggle to negotiate with creditors without a lawyer. This makes it harder to achieve a manageable debt repayment plan or discharge.
